What Is A Bilingualism?

What Is A Bilingualism? A bilingual person is someone who speaks two languages. A person who speaks more than two languages is called ‘multilingual’ (although the term ‘bilingualism’ can be used for both situations). … It’s possible for a person to know and use three, four, or even more languages fluently. What Is The Problem With Bilingual Education?

What Is The Problem With Bilingual Education? Aside from basic reading materials and basic arithmetic, very little is commercially available in support of bilingual education, especially for secondary students. What Is Bilingual Language Acquisition?

What Is Bilingual Language Acquisition? Bilingual children acquire the same proficiency in the phonological and grammatical aspects of their two languages as monolingual children do in their one language, provided they are given regular and substantial exposure to each.
